What homeowners should know

Key indicators of the roof's condition include age, visible damage, or wear and tear, such as missing shingles, curling edges, or cracks, which often suggest that it is time to not only assess the cost of replacement or repairs but to also consult with a qualified contractor regarding the severity of the damage and the physical state of the underlying structure. Weather patterns in your region and unexpected severe weather events can adversely affect your roof's durability, while long-term exposure to sun, wind, rain, and snow can accelerate deterioration; hence, an evaluation of climatic influences alongside regular roof inspections is vital to forecast potential costs and necessary interventions accurately.

Important factors to consider

Additionally, it is prudent to monitor energy bills as an unexpected spike in costs may signal that your roof is not performing efficiently, necessitating energy-efficient upgrades or replacements that align with modern roofing technology and environmental standards. Furthermore, an inspection of your attic or roof's insulation could reveal moisture damage or poor ventilation that affects the roofing system-these considerations highlight the importance of taking a holistic approach when assessing roofing needs and related costs.

What to do next

A critical aspect often overlooked is the financial implications of delayed roofing maintenance or replacement; ignoring early signs of roof damage can lead to more extensive and expensive repairs down the line, including potential damage to interior structures or personal belongings, which accentuates the urgent need for timely intervention. Engaging with a reputable roofing professional who can perform a comprehensive assessment will empower you to make informed decisions based on expert guidance, while also considering factors such as the material quality, aesthetic options, and long-term warranties that can influence both immediate costs and long-term satisfaction with your investment.
